Then it is clearly a scam! Such fraudulent sellers lure with unusually low prices and then try to process the order "past Amazon". If you fall for it and pay directly to the seller, then the money is gone and you NEVER get any goods.
The Amazon buyer protection (A-Z guarantee from Amazon) does NOT apply in such cases because the order and payment were NOT processed through properly Amazon.
